• 关于我们
  • 产品
  • 数字圈
  • 区块链
Sign in Get Started

                              比特币钱包的实现原理解析2025-05-21 16:39:30

                              引言

                              比特币钱包是用户管理比特币的工具,能够使用户安全地发送和接收比特币。在比特币的运作过程中,钱包扮演着至关重要的角色。了解比特币钱包的实现原理,不仅有助于更好地使用比特币,还能帮助用户提高安全意识,防范潜在的风险。

                              比特币钱包的基本概念

                                 
比特币钱包的实现原理解析

                              比特币钱包是一种软件工具,用于存储、发送和接收比特币。它的主要功能是存储用户的私钥,并通过这些私钥对比特币交易进行签名。可以将比特币钱包视为一种数字银行账户,它并不直接存储比特币,而是存储与比特币网络中的地址相关联的私钥。

                              私钥与公钥组成了比特币钱包的基础。每个比特币钱包都有一对公钥和私钥,公钥用于生成比特币地址,用户可以将该地址分享给其他人以接收比特币;而私钥则是保护比特币安全的核心,它需要被严密保管,以防止未授权的访问。

                              比特币钱包的类型

                              比特币钱包有多种类型,其中主要包括以下几种:

                              1. **软件钱包**:安装在电脑或手机上的钱包应用,分为热钱包和冷钱包。热钱包连接互联网,方便实时交易;冷钱包则离线,适合长期存储。

                              2. **硬件钱包**:专用设备,提供高安全性的存储环境。用户可以将私钥保存在硬件钱包中,避免被恶意软件攻击。

                              3. **纸钱包**:将比特币地址和私钥打印在纸上,离线保存。纸钱包难以被黑客入侵,但易于遗失或损毁。

                              4. **在线钱包**:托管在云端的平台,用户可以通过浏览器访问。这种钱包操作方便,但由于托管在第三方平台上,其安全性相对较低。

                              比特币钱包的工作原理

                                 
比特币钱包的实现原理解析

                              比特币钱包的实现原理主要依赖于区块链技术,它的核心是交易的数据结构和加密技术。以下是比特币钱包实现的几个关键方面:

                              1. 地址生成

                              比特币钱包首先需要生成用户的比特币地址。这一过程涉及到通过加密算法生成一对公钥和私钥。用户的私钥是随机生成的,具有高度的安全性,而公钥是通过对私钥进行椭圆曲线加密算法(ECDSA)运算得出的。比特币地址通常是公钥哈希后的结果,可用于接收比特币。

                              2. 交易签名

                              在发送比特币时,钱包会生成交易信息,包括发送方地址、接收方地址和转账金额等。同时,用私钥对交易信息进行数字签名,确保只有拥有该私钥的用户才能进行交易。数字签名是利用私钥生成的,任何人都可以使用公钥验证该签名的有效性。

                              3. 交易广播与确认

                              签名后的交易数据会被广播到比特币网络中,矿工会将其纳入区块进行验证。验证通过后,这笔交易将被纳入区块链,正式记录在账本上。比特币钱包通过访问区块链,查询余额和交易历史,从而实现用户对比特币的管理。

                              4. 私钥管理

                              私钥的安全性至关重要,钱包会采取各种措施保护私钥的安全。例如,硬件钱包会将私钥存储在安全芯片中,不与外部设备直接交互;软件钱包则可能会使用密码加密私钥,甚至采用分层确定性钱包(HD钱包)来提升安全性。

                              比特币钱包的安全性

                              比特币钱包的安全性是用户最关心的问题之一。钱包的安全性不仅取决于技术实现,也取决于用户的操作习惯。以下是一些建议,帮助用户提高比特币钱包的安全性:

                              1. **使用硬件钱包**:硬件钱包硬件隔离,有助于防止恶意软件的攻击。

                              2. **启用双因素认证**:在支持的在线钱包上,启用双因素认证(2FA)可以增加额外的安全保护层。

                              3. **定期备份**:定期备份钱包数据,包括私钥、助记词等信息,以防丢失。

                              4. **保持软件更新**:随时关注钱包软件的更新,及时修补潜在的安全漏洞。

                              常见问题

                              比特币钱包丢失私钥怎么办?

                              丢失私钥是比特币用户最担心的问题之一,因为一旦私钥丢失,用户将无法再访问存储在该地址下的比特币。以下是应对丢失私钥的一些建议:

                              首先,签署交易的私钥是比特币钱包的唯一访问权,失去私钥就意味着失去比特币。如果用户使用的是硬件钱包,钱包本身可能提供恢复功能,通过助记词或恢复种子恢复钱包。而如果没有备份,用户需要承认这些比特币永远丢失。

                              此外,为了避免这种情况的发生,用户应在创建比特币钱包时将助记词和私钥与设备分离保管,并保留多份备份。理想情况下,用户可以将备份存放在不同地点,以进一步降低风险。

                              如何选择合适的比特币钱包?

                              选择合适的比特币钱包需考虑多个因素,包括安全性、易用性、功能以及对用户需求的适应性。以下是选择比特币钱包时需要注意的几点:

                              首先,了解自己的需求。如果用户频繁交易,选择热钱包较为合适;若希望长期存储并保持安全,推荐使用冷钱包或硬件钱包。其次、安全性是选择钱包的重中之重,需查看钱包的安全机制是否强大,用户评价如何。

                              此外,界面友好、操作简单的钱包会更容易上手,特别是对没有经验的用户。功能方面,支持多币种的钱包,或能够方便地进行交易分析,更能满足用户的需求。

                              最后,需注意钱包的使用费用,即支付交易费的条件。此外,对于较大金额的资金,优先选择知名品牌和具有好评的服务提供商。

                              比特币钱包的交易费用怎么算?

                              交易费用是用户在进行比特币交易时需要支付的费用,主要用于激励矿工确认和处理交易。比特币网络会根据网络的拥堵程度动态调整交易费用,从而影响用户的交易成本。以下是关于比特币交易费用的详细信息:

                              1. **交易费用的组成**:比特币交易费用主要由两个部分构成:矿工费用和网络费用。矿工费用是支付给确认和打包交易的矿工,网络费用则是网络上的平均交易费率。

                              2. **如何计算费用**:交易费用通常以每字节费用的形式计算,数据包越大,产生的费用相对越高。用户可以根据当前网络的拥堵情况,通过第三方服务或钱包提供的工具来估算发生的交易费用。

                              3. **管理费用策略**:用户在实际应用中,可以选择“快速”、“普通”或“慢速”几种类型的费用策略。快速策略会提供较高的费用,确保交易迅速确认,而慢速费用则适用于不急于交易的情况。合理管理费用策略不仅能减少支出,也能应对不同情况下的需求。

                              比特币钱包能否进行隐私保护?

                              隐私保护是比特币交易中的一个重要话题,因为区块链上所有交易都是公开可见的。用户应如何在使用比特币钱包时保护自己的隐私呢?以下是一些建议:

                              1. **使用混合器服务**:比特币混合器是通过混合不同用户的交易来提高匿名性的一种服务。用户在发送比特币时,可以通过混合器进行交易,这样可以减少交易能追踪到具体用户地址的可能性。

                              2. **使用分层确定性钱包(HD钱包)**:HD钱包可以为用户生成多个地址,便于在交易过程中保持地址的新颖性。用户在保护隐私的同时,也能提高管理效率。

                              3. **定期更换地址**:每次收款时使用不同的比特币地址,可以提高交易的隐私性。这是因为链上活动不容易直接与固定地址关联。

                              4. **结合使用VPN/Tor**:在进行比特币交易时,结合使用VPN或Tor等隐私保护工具,可以降低自身IP地址被泄露的风险,从而更好地保护用户的交易隐私。

                              总结

                              比特币钱包的实现原理是比特币生态系统中一个复杂而重要的部分。通过对比特币钱包的深入理解,用户不仅能够安心地管理和使用自己的比特币资产,也能提高自身的安全意识,防范潜在的风险。希望通过本文的介绍,能够帮助您更全面地了解比特币钱包,更有效地进行比特币管理。

                              注册我们的时事通讯

                              我们的进步

                              本周热门

                              浏览器以太坊钱包:方便
                              浏览器以太坊钱包:方便
                              如何查询以太坊钱包地址
                              如何查询以太坊钱包地址
                                如何为区块链钱包起名:
                              如何为区块链钱包起名:
                              以太坊钱包能存储哪些资
                              以太坊钱包能存储哪些资
                              以太坊钱包注册操作指南
                              以太坊钱包注册操作指南

                                        地址

                                        Address : 1234 lock, Charlotte, North Carolina, United States

                                        Phone : +12 534894364

                                        Email : info@example.com

                                        Fax : +12 534894364

                                        快速链接

                                        • 关于我们
                                        • 产品
                                        • 数字圈
                                        • 区块链
                                        • tokenim钱包app
                                        • tokenim官网app

                                        通讯

                                        通过订阅我们的邮件列表,您将始终从我们这里获得最新的新闻和更新。

                                        tokenim钱包app

                                        tokenim钱包app是一款多链钱包,支持多条区块链,包括BTC、ETH、BSC、TRON、Aptos、Polygon、Solana、Cosmos、Polkadot、EOS、IOST等。您可以在一个平台上方便地管理多种数字资产,无需频繁切换钱包。
                                        我们致力于为您提供最安全的数字资产管理解决方案,让您能够安心地掌控自己的财富。无论您是普通用户还是专业投资者,tokenim钱包app都是您信赖的选择。

                                        • facebook
                                        • twitter
                                        • google
                                        • linkedin

                                        2003-2025 tokenim官网 @版权所有|网站地图|沪ICP备14020979号

                                                            Login Now
                                                            We'll never share your email with anyone else.

                                                            Don't have an account?

                                                            <abbr dropzone="hl4zv_"></abbr><ol id="d4hx2x"></ol><style date-time="on0pll"></style><kbd dir="bj71_j"></kbd><ul draggable="_rspiq"></ul><legend date-time="zvzbbf"></legend><pre id="69e946"></pre><b dropzone="jk2x2g"></b><ol date-time="3pmhlb"></ol><code dir="ohnssw"></code><center date-time="slqccc"></center><em draggable="a13klx"></em><abbr dir="rvc4t3"></abbr><em dir="yk04ub"></em><ins lang="iwvg6m"></ins><abbr id="57_1m5"></abbr><noframes id="5vmjnv">
                                                                Register Now

                                                                By clicking Register, I agree to your terms